About William

The instructor is an undergraduate at The Ohio State University studying political science on a pre-law track, with a background in analytic philosophy. He scored in the 99th percentile on the LSAT and has published two law review articles, on Fourth Amendment doctrine and on automated decision-making, and clerks at a legal aid tax clinic. That combination, scoring at the top of the test while actively working in legal research and writing, means the LSAT is taught not as an isolated exam but as the reasoning that underlies legal work itself.
The teaching approach reflects an academic rather than a commercial orientation. The emphasis is on the formal structure beneath each question type, so that students leave with methods they can apply independently rather than answers to memorize. Feedback is direct and specific, and progress is measured by whether a student can explain their own reasoning, not by time spent in sessions.

These lessons are built for students who already know the basics of the LSAT and are working to move into the 170s, the range where additional points come from correcting reasoning errors rather than completing more practice questions. The instructor's background is in political science and analytic philosophy, and the method treats the test as a system of formal logic: conditional reasoning, necessary and sufficient conditions, and argument structure are taught as transferable skills rather than memorized tricks.

A typical session opens with a review of the student's recent practice questions to identify the specific question types and reasoning patterns costing points. It then moves to targeted drilling on those types, with each missed question worked through until the student can state why the correct answer is correct and why the trap answer fails. Sessions close with a written study plan for the days in between.
The approach is direct and feedback-driven. The instructor scored in the 99th percentile on the LSAT and has published two undergraduate law review articles, and treats the underlying logic, rather than the score itself, as the subject being taught.
